This will be the 2nd time that Jelena Ostapenko and Lauren Davis fight against each other. The head to head is 1-0 for Davis (see full H2H stats), but they have never played each other on clay.

Jelena Ostapenko

Ranked no. 43, Ostapenko will start her run in Strasbourg after she played her last match in Rome where she lost 6-4 6-3 to Linette in the 1st round the 14th of September.

Ostapenko has a 4-5 win-loss record in 2020, 0-1 on clay (See FULL STATS).

Talking about her overall career, The Latvian has an overall 267-166 record. She has positive 81-36 record on clay.

Lauren Davis

Ranked no. 67, Davis will start her run in Strasbourg after she played her last match in Rome where she lost 6-4 6-1 to in the qualifications the 12th of September.

The American has a 5-9 win-loss record in 2020, 0-1 on clay (See FULL STATS).

In terms of her career, The American has an overall 294-212 record. She has positive 69-41 record on clay.
